The History of Old-School Slots
The development of casino slots began in the closing 19th century with the creation of the first mechanical slot machines. Developed by Charles Fey in San Francisco, these machines featured three spinning reels and a one payline. The Liberty Bell, as it was known, included images like horseshoe symbols, diamond shapes, and the famous bell, leading to its name. Players would pull a switch to spin the reels, and a set of symbols would determine their prizes.
As the popularity of these machines spread across the United States, more variations emerged. Creators began to add features like more reels and different symbols to enhance the play experience. The early 20th century saw the launch of electric slot machines, which provided even more entertainment and chances for players. These innovations led to the founding of numerous casinos, further nesting slots into the core of gambling culture.
Classic slots continued to progress throughout the years, but their core mechanics remained anchored in Fey’s original design. The simplicity and thrill of spinning reels attracted a diverse range of players, from casual gamblers to more serious bettors. This solidified the reputation of casino slots games as a staple attraction in both physical casinos and later online platforms, setting the stage for the electronic revolution to come.
The Emergence of Video Slots
The introduction of video slots marked a major turning point in the history of casino slots games. These innovative machines replaced the traditional mechanical reels with colorful graphics and animated animations, captivating players in unique manners. The shift from physical to virtual enabled developers to liberate themselves from the limitations of classic designs, leading to the birth of engaging themes and storylines that pulled in a wider audience.
As technology advanced, video slots became more user-friendly and intuitive. They provided engaging elements such as special bonuses, free spins, and multiple payout options, enhancing the overall gaming experience. Players were no longer limited to simple gameplay; rather, they could enjoy an range of engaging experiences that attracted different tastes and desires. This evolution attracted both experienced gamblers and beginners, substantially broadening the market for casino slots games.
The growth of internet casinos further accelerated the popularity of digital slot machines. With the ability to bet from home or on smartphones, players realized a easy and entertaining option for their gaming needs. Online venues introduced a vast selection of video slots, often with one-of-a-kind titles and cumulative prizes that were not found in brick-and-mortar casinos. This ease of access and diversity transformed the landscape of slot gaming, establishing digital slot machines as a leading force in the gaming world.
